Water Pipe Network Management System

  • Support for managing runoff rate, leak rate, demand pattern, abnormal signs, etc. through specialized expert systems and pattern management techniques.
  • Applying the Waterworks GIS and providing management functions for each large, medium, and small block to help users use it intuitively and easily.
  • By quickly and accurately estimating the amount of leakage in real time by flow rate and water pressure analysis, convenience of pre-response and confirmation of results before and after the problem occurs is secured.

Block data analysis

  • Automatic/manual generation and analysis of supply patterns.
  • Calculation of leakage amount and analysis of runoff rate/leakage rate.

Measurement data analysis

  • Flow rate and water pressure data analysis.
  • Operation of water supply facilities.
  • Alarm power due to high pressure and malfunction of facilities.

Proper water pressure management

  • Estimation of real-time water pressure through water pipes according to changes in drainage level.
  • Provide guidelines for proper water pressure using automatic threshold determination techniques.

Decision making support

  • Data analysis-based flow rate, water pressure, event detection.
  • Suggest action plan to operator using multiple decision-making technique
